Does anyone have a northwest off road header on there 22re? I put one on mine and i and getting a O2 sensor code. I heard it might be that the o2 sensor is not heating up as much and that could be throwing a code. Anyone have this problem?

I heard somewhere that the NWOR 22RE headers are made by Stan's Headers in Auburn WA but that NWOR has the exclusive rights to sell them under their moniker. Because of this I would rather get my headers direct from the maker. It just so happens that they have a website: http://www.stans-headers.com/toyota_headers.htm Because of all the problems that people have had with NWOR (No Warranty Or Returns) I would not waste my money buying anything that they have for sale anymore.

I like the header otherwise. It bolts up easy and it does add a little noticeable power. Also, it doesn't leak like the stock cracked manifold.
